Summary

“Running Close to the Wind” by Alexandra Rowland is an unapologetically unhinged seafaring fantasy that combines chaotic queer pirates, mystifying turtle astronomy, dangerous sea serpents during breeding season, loveable glowing dogs, and an absurd cake competition. The story follows Avra Helvaçi, a former field agent of the Araşti Ministry of Intelligence, who accidentally steals the single most expensive secret in the world. To escape, Avra must turn to the pirate Captain Teveri az-Ḥaffār for help. Together, they hatch a plan to take the information to the isolated pirate republic of the Isles of Lost Souls, where they hope to profit from their daring venture. However, obstacles stand in their way, including a calculating Araşti ambassador, Brother Julian with his own secrets, and the perilous sea serpent breeding season
